Welcome to team Bramblewick! One thing you'll hit early: our circuit breaker around the Ospray upstream API. It trips after five consecutive failures and cools down for a minute, so don't panic when staging calls suddenly 503 — check the breaker dashboard first. Breaker counters live in a small shared database, which you can reach with the connection string below.

replica DSN, kajep-yahag: mssql://praok_svc:iF@db-8d68.plorvaio.local:5432/eliion

Finance Review Summary — Heads of Department. Quick rundown on retiring the Bramblewick line: revenue has slid 18% year over year, and margins are now thinner than our cheapest accessories. Warehouse carrying costs alone eat most of the remaining contribution. We propose a wind-down over two quarters, with clearance pricing in month one and supplier contract exits by month four. Nobody loses headcount; teams shift to the Fernhollow range. Questions welcome at Thursday's session. The bigger-picture thinking is captured in the note just below.

internal memo for tajof-kaduf: Only 65 of the 511 pilot accounts renewed Lamdor, so a churn review is set for January 26. Aldmirek Works is in early talks to buy Alddorox Works for about $490.9 million.

**Ticket: Scanner config drift between warehouse nodes**

The Beltline barcode scanner integration is behaving differently on the Kessler Yard nodes versus the main floor. Symbology whitelist and debounce intervals were hand-edited during the November rollout and never synced back to the repo. Reconciling before we enable batch mode. For reference, the values currently deployed on the drifted nodes are these.

config for tajof-yaguf:
[istox]
team = aldius
access_code = ac_29be1b
owner = holok.praix
host = istox.zarqelsoft.test
port = 11211
peer = novath.olvarqio.example
salt = 983a9dc6
pin = 4652

First-Day Checklist Item 7 — Lost-Badge Procedure

Walk the new starter through what to do if their badge goes missing. They should report it to the Hollin Street reception immediately, in person or by phone, so the badge can be deactivated before anyone misuses it. A temporary day pass is issued on the spot; a replacement badge takes up to two working days. Until the replacement arrives, they can reach their floor via the keypad by the west doors, using the temporary code below.

badge for fahop-fawip: bdg-EZRSJ-25213